Responsibilities
Performs remote interrogations of pacemakers, defibrillators, implantable loop recorders, wearable defibrillators, and cardiac contractility modulation (CCM) devices using device company websites and clinic software. Responsible for scheduling appointments, following up with patients on missed transmissions, importing reports, inputting data in the proper systems and preparing reports for the physician and the billing department.
Qualifications
Education: High School graduate or equivalent required. Heart rhythm monitor experience preferred. Previous medical assistant experience or graduate of an accredited medical assistant program preferred.
Licensure/Certification: BLS certification required within six (6) months of hire.
Experience: One (1) plus year of clinical experience preferred in the role of Medical Assistant, LPN, certified EKG Technician or CRAT certified position.
